Training Programs for Data Modeling: Developing Your Skills in Structured Data
In today’s information-driven world, data is one of the most valuable assets an organization can possess. However, raw data alone has limited value unless it is organized and structured effectively. This is where data modeling training courses come into play. These courses equip professionals and students with the knowledge and practical skills to design structured, scalable, and efficient database systems that form the backbone of modern applications and analytics platforms.
Whether you are a database administrator, data analyst, software developer, or aspiring data engineer, enrolling in a data modeling training course can provide a strong foundation in managing, structuring, and optimizing data for real-world use.
What Is Data Modeling?
Data modeling is the process of creating a blueprint for how data is organized, stored, and interrelated within a system. It defines entities, attributes, and the relationships between them to ensure data accuracy, integrity, and accessibility.
Training courses in data modeling help learners translate business requirements into technical designs that can be implemented in databases. This involves creating visual diagrams, structuring data relationships, and optimizing storage for performance and scalability.
Core Levels of Data Modeling Covered in Training Courses
1. Conceptual Data Modeling
Conceptual modeling provides a high-level view of the data landscape. It focuses on understanding the business requirements and identifying the main entities and their relationships.
For example, in a hospital management system, entities may include:
-
Patient
-
Doctor
-
Appointment
-
Prescription
At this level, learners practice creating entity-relationship diagrams (ERDs) to communicate business rules clearly without worrying about technical implementation.
2. Logical Data Modeling
Logical modeling translates conceptual designs into detailed structures, adding attributes, keys, and constraints. It defines how data elements relate logically without considering the specific database technology.
Key elements include:
-
Attributes of each entity
-
Primary and foreign keys
-
Relationship types (one-to-one, one-to-many, many-to-many)
-
Normalization techniques to eliminate redundancy and ensure consistency
Training at this stage teaches learners how to create databases that are reliable, consistent, and free from anomalies.
3. Physical Data Modeling
Physical modeling focuses on implementing the logical model within a specific database management system. It considers performance, storage, and indexing strategies to ensure the system operates efficiently in real-world environments.
Topics typically covered include:
-
Table creation and column specifications
-
Indexing and query optimization
-
Data integrity constraints
-
Storage allocation and performance tuning
-
Security and access management
Through physical modeling, learners understand how to deploy databases that are both efficient and maintainable.
Key Skills Gained from Data Modeling Training Courses
Completing a data modeling course allows participants to master:
-
Creating entity-relationship diagrams (ERDs)
-
Applying normalization and denormalization techniques
-
Designing logical and physical database schemas
-
Implementing data integrity rules with constraints
-
Building dimensional models for business intelligence and analytics
-
Using modeling tools and database platforms for practical implementation
These skills are valuable across industries such as finance, healthcare, retail, technology, and government.
Benefits of Enrolling in Data Modeling Training Courses
1. Practical Knowledge
Courses include hands-on projects and exercises that prepare learners for real-world database design and implementation.
2. Career Advancement
Data modeling is a critical skill for roles including:
-
Data Analyst
-
Database Administrator
-
Data Engineer
-
Data Architect
-
Business Intelligence Developer
Professionals with formal training in data modeling are more competitive in the job market.
3. Structured Learning
Training courses provide a step-by-step approach, starting from fundamental concepts to advanced techniques, ensuring learners develop a comprehensive understanding of data modeling.
4. Efficiency and Accuracy
Learning how to structure and optimize data reduces redundancy, improves consistency, and enhances the overall performance of database systems.
Choosing the Right Data Modeling Training Course
When selecting a course, consider the following:
-
Skill Level: Beginners may choose introductory courses focusing on ERDs and database fundamentals, while intermediate or advanced learners can opt for courses covering normalization, dimensional modeling, and performance tuning.
-
Hands-On Projects: Practical exercises and real-world projects help reinforce learning.
-
Tools and Software: Courses that introduce modeling and database software provide an added advantage for real-world applications.
-
Certification: Courses offering certificates can validate skills for employers and enhance career opportunities.
Real-World Applications
Data modeling training courses often include project-based learning, such as:
-
Designing a retail inventory database
-
Modeling a hospital or healthcare system
-
Creating a banking or financial transaction database
-
Developing a university course registration system
These projects ensure that learners can apply theoretical knowledge to practical scenarios, preparing them for professional challenges.
The Importance of Data Modeling in Modern Systems
With the rise of cloud computing, big data, and real-time analytics, structured data design is more critical than ever. Modern courses may also cover:
-
Cloud-based database design
-
NoSQL and hybrid database architectures
-
Real-time data processing
-
Data governance, security, and compliance
Despite evolving technologies, the core principles of data modeling remain essential for creating reliable and scalable data systems.
Conclusion
Data modeling training courses provide the knowledge, skills, and practical experience necessary to design efficient, scalable, and accurate database systems. By mastering conceptual, logical, and physical data modeling, learners can create systems that support analytics, business intelligence, and enterprise operations.
Investing in data modeling training enhances career opportunities, strengthens technical expertise, and equips professionals to handle the growing demands of data-driven organizations. Structured learning in this field is a critical step toward becoming a proficient data professional in today’s competitive technology landscape.
Comments
Post a Comment